OSHA Inspection: U.S. TRAILER PARTS & SUPPLY, INC.

Complaint inspection · Safety discipline

On , OSHA opened a complaint safety inspection of U.S. TRAILER PARTS & SUPPLY, INC. in 4334 S. TRIPP AVE., CHICAGO, IL 60632 (NAICS 336390). OSHA activity number 342986171.

What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.178(l)(1)(i): The employer did not ensure that each powered industrial truck operator is competent to operate a powered industrial truck safely, as demonstrated by the successful completion of the training and evaluation specified in this paragraph (l):   On or about March 1, 2018,  employees operated forklift trucks (sit down and stand up) without the employer ensuring the employees were competent by successfully completing training and evaluation exposing the employee to struck  by and crushing hazards.   In accordance with 29CFR 1903.19(d), abatement certification is required for this violation (using CERTIFICATION OF CORRECTIVE ACTION WORKSHEET), and in addition, documentation that abatement is complete must be included with your certification. This documentation may include, but is not limited to, evidence of the purchase or repair of the equipment, photographic or video evidence of abatement or other written records.

29 CFR 1910.38(b): An emergency action plan was not in writing, kept in the workplace, and available to employees for review.   On March 1, 2018, an emergency action plan did not exist in the establishment,  preventing employees from having a plan of what to do in case of an emergency such as a fire.   Certification, with date and method of abatement required.  Certification of abatement is required by 29 CFR Part 1903 and is to be submitted within (10) calendar days after the abatement date.

29 CFR 1910.39(b): A fire prevention plan was not in writing, kept in the workplace, and be made available to employees for review.   On March 1, 2018, a fire prevention plan did not exist in the establishment,  preventing employees from protection from fires.   Certification, with date and method of abatement required.  Certification of abatement is required by 29 CFR Part 1903 and is to be submitted within (10) calendar days after the abatement date.
